CLOUD COMPUTING (Komputer Di Awan)
Pendahuluan Dengan kemajuan dan perkembangan internet, aplikasi desktop atau bahkan device yang biasa kita jalankan atau gunakan di komputer rumah, sekarang dapat dijalankan online melalui jaringan internet (cloud). seperti sistem operasi, software edit photo, tempat penyimpanan, anti virus, dll. Cloud computing adalah teknologi yang menggunakan internet dan server pusat yang jauh untuk menjaga/mengelola data dan aplikasi. Cloud computing membantu konsumen dan pebisnis untuk menggunakan aplikasi tanpa melakukan instalasi, mengakses file pribadi mereka di komputer manapun dengan akses internet. Teknologi ini memungkinkan efisiensi lebih dengan memusatkan penyimpanan, memory, pemrosesan, dan bandwith
Definisi Ada beberapa definisi mengenai cloud computing diantaranya adalah Menurut sebuah makalah tahun 2008 yang dipublikasi IEEE Internet Computing : “Cloud Computing adalah suatu paradigma di mana informasi secara permanen tersimpan di server di internet dan tersimpan secara sementara di komputer pengguna (client) termasuk di dalamnya adalah desktop, komputer tablet, notebook, komputer tembok, handheld, sensor-sensor, monitor dan lain-lain.” Stevan Greve : “Internet bisa dianggap awan besar. Awan berisi komputer yang semuanya saling tersambung. Dari situlah berasal istilah ‘cloud’. Jadi semuanya disambungkan ke ‘cloud’, atau awan itu. Cloud computing adalah gaya komputasi di mana sumber daya secara dinamis terukur dan seringkali tersedia secara virtual sebagai layanan melalui internet. Pengguna tidak perlu memiliki pengetahuan, keahlian, atau kontrol atas infrastruktur teknologi di awan yang mendukungnya.
Dari definisi diatas dapat disimpulkan bahwa : CLOUD : Awan (Internet) dan COMPUTING : Proses komputasi Penggunaan teknologi komputer untuk pengembangan berbasis Internet dengan piranti lunak lengkap dan sistem operasional juga tersedia secara online. Dengan kata lain, internet & semua yg terkait dengannya, menjadi terminal pusat
Komponen Cloud Computing Cloud Clients : seperangkat komputer / software yg didesain secara khusus utk penggunaan layanan berbasis cloud computing. Cloud Services : produk, layanan dan solusi yang dipakai dan disampaikan secara real-time melalui media Internet. Contoh yang paling popular adalah web service. Cloud Applications memanfaatkan cloud computing dalam hal arsitektur software. Sehingga user tidak perlu menginstal dan menjalankan aplikasi dengan menggunakan komputer. Cloud Platform : merupakan layanan berupa platform komputasi yang berisi hardware dan software2 infrasktruktur. Cloud Storage melibatkan proses penyampaian penyimpanan data sebagai sebuah layanan. Cloud Infrastructure merupakan penyampaian infrastruktur komputasi sebagai sebuah layanan.
Implementasi Contoh cloud computing adalah Yahoo email atau Gmail. Anda tidak perlu software atau server untuk menggunakannya. Semua konsumen hanya perlu koneksi internet dan mereka dapat mulai mengirimkan email. Software manajemen email dan server semuanya ada di cloud (internet) dan secara total dikelola oleh provider seperti Yahoo, Google, etc. Konsumen hanya perlu menggunakan software itu sendiri dan menikmati manfaatnya. Analoginya adalah, “Jika and membutuhkan susu, kenapa membeli sapi?” Yang semua pengguna butuhkan adalah manfaat menggunakan software atau hardware seperti mengirim email dll. Hanya untuk mendapatkan manfaat ini (susu) mengapa konsumen harus membeli sapi (software/hardware)